Location Details

Postcode EH21 8SF
Outcode EH21
Sector EH21 8
Street Old Craighall Road

Administrative Areas

District East Lothian
Country Scotland
Constituency East Lothian

Map

Nearby Train Stations 4 found

TfL
Musselburgh Train Station
Railway Station
1.1 miles
TfL
Brunstane Train Station
Railway Station
1.9 miles
TfL
Wallyford Train Station
Railway Station
2.4 miles
TfL
Newtongrange Train Station
Railway Station
3.9 miles